Physiotherapy
What Parents May Notice
Mobility challenges, posture issues, balance difficulties, or physical weakness.
How Therapy Helps
Physiotherapy supports movement, posture, strength, flexibility, and physical development through guided exercises and intervention.
Expected Outcomes
- Better posture and balance
- Improved mobility and coordination
- Increased physical confidence
Occupational Therapy
What Parents May Notice
Difficulty with daily tasks, poor coordination, sensory issues, or trouble focusing.
How Therapy Helps
Occupational therapy improves sensory processing, motor coordination, attention, and everyday functional skills.
Expected Outcomes
- Improved daily routine skills
- Better sensory regulation
- Enhanced coordination and independence
Sensory Integration Therapy
What Parents May Notice
Sensitivity to touch, sound, movement, textures, or difficulty processing surroundings.
How Therapy Helps
Sensory integration therapy helps children respond more comfortably and effectively to sensory experiences.
Expected Outcomes
- Better sensory response
- Improved focus and calmness
- Greater comfort in daily environments
Speech Therapy
What Parents May Notice
Difficulty speaking clearly, delayed speech, limited vocabulary, or challenges expressing needs.
How Therapy Helps
Speech therapy supports communication, language development, listening skills, and confidence in expressing thoughts and emotions.
Expected Outcomes
- Better communication skills
- Improved speech clarity
- Increased confidence in social interaction
Behavioural Therapy
What Parents May Notice
Emotional outbursts, difficulty adapting to routines, social challenges, or behavioural concerns.
How Therapy Helps
Behavioural therapy helps children develop emotional regulation, social interaction skills, and adaptive behaviour.
Expected Outcomes
- Improved behaviour management
- Better emotional understanding
- Enhanced social interaction
Special Education
What Parents May Notice
Learning difficulties, academic struggles, or challenges understanding classroom tasks.
How Therapy Helps
Special education programs provide personalized learning strategies based on each child’s strengths and developmental needs.
Expected Outcomes
- Improved learning abilities
- Better academic confidence
- Child-focused educational support
